Abstract
The epoxy resin insulators on the roof of high-speed train work in an outdoor environment for a long time, and the aging umbrella skirt edge will form a gap when it is hit by a hard object, and the broken umbrella skirt will reduce the creepage distance, which may induce a flashover fault and even cause the train power supply interruption. A model including defect location, defect shape and radial defect depth was constructed and its potential distribution was calculated. Calculation results show that, with the constant defect shape and defect area, the local electric field strength distortion is the largest when the defect location is in the first umbrella skirt at the high-voltage end; the local electric field strength distortion rate is higher than that of the crescent-shaped defect with the shape of the broken area being triangular with the defect location and defect area in constant. When the defect location and shape are in constant, the decrease in creepage distance and the distortion rate of electric field strength increase with the increase of radial depth of the defect. The calculation results can provide a reference for evaluating the influence of insulator defects on the electric field distribution.
